Recording Date and Song Details

George Jones - White Lightning
Cover LP George Jones Mercury 1959
Recorded in 1959, «White Lightning» was penned by J.P. Richardson, famously known as The Big Bopper. With producer Pappy Daily at the helm, the song found its place on Jones’ debut album, «White Lightning and Other Favorites.» Swiftly, it soared to the top of the country charts, solidifying its status as a timeless classic, this masterpiece managed to reach the hearts of country music fans, reaching number 1 in US Hot Country Songs (Billboard) and number 73 in the US. Billboard Hot 100.

The Meaning Behind «White Lightning»

The song chronicles the tale of a bootlegger and his knack for brewing a potent whiskey dubbed «White Lightning.» This playful and energetic narrative captures the essence of rural Southern American living, where resourcefulness and daring are commonplace.




George Jones: A Country Icon

George Jones - No Money in This DealGeorge Jones, affectionately dubbed «The Possum,» stands as an undisputed legend of country music. With a career spanning decades, Jones amassed over a dozen number-one singles on the charts, including «He Stopped Loving Her Today» and «She Thinks I Still Care.» His unmistakable voice and ability to convey emotion have left an indelible mark on the country music landscape.
